Company Description
Guardant Health is a leading precision oncology company focused on guarding wellness and giving every person more time free from cancer. Founded in 2012, Guardant is transforming patient care and accelerating new cancer therapies by providing critical insights into what drives disease through its advanced blood and tissue tests, real-world data and AI analytics. Guardant tests help improve outcomes across all stages of care, including screening to find cancer early, monitoring for recurrence in early-stage cancer, and treatment selection for patients with advanced cancer. The Senior Director, Performance & Digital Marketing will set strategy and lead execution for all paid media, advertising, and digital marketing across Guardant Health's screening division, including for: Consumer, Healthcare Provider (HCP), and Health Systems audiences.
A central responsibility of this role is leadership of Shield's significant multi-million-dollar national direct-to-consumer (DTC) media investment across television, streaming, digital video, search, social, programmatic, CRM, and emerging channels. This leader will be accountable for ensuring that the investment builds the Shield brand, increases consumer demand, drives measurable action, and contributes to commercial growth.
Beyond DTC, the Senior Director will oversee the integrated media and digital ecosystem for HCP and Health Systems audiences, including professional media, account-based marketing, web, CRM, marketing automation, organic social, and conversion optimization.
As a senior member of the Screening Marketing leadership team, this individual will establish portfolio-wide investment priorities, performance standards, agency models, measurement frameworks, and digital capabilities. The role requires strong commercial judgment, financial discipline, cross-functional collaboration, executive influence, and the ability to translate a significant marketing investment into measurable business impact.
The ideal candidate is an accomplished performance and digital marketing leader who combines strategic vision, analytical rigor, and organizational leadership. They must be able to influence senior stakeholders, challenge agency and internal thinking, make disciplined investment decisions, and build a high-performing team in a fast-moving, highly regulated environment.
